Calconic ‑ Calculator Builder and Quick Quote are both Shopify apps addressing pricing and quotation needs, but they cater to distinct use cases. Calconic, despite its lower rating (4.1/5 from 19 reviews), likely focuses on enabling merchants to embed complex calculation tools directly onto their storefront. This benefits businesses offering customizable products or services with dynamic pricing based on various customer inputs. Quick Quote, on the other hand, clearly centers on facilitating a quote request process through the customer's cart. Its high rating (5/5 from 56 reviews) and feature set suggest it is designed for businesses that prefer a personalized quoting system, allowing customers to request specific pricing based on their needs and for the merchant to then respond with tailored offers. The core difference lies in the level of automation and immediacy. Calconic aims to provide immediate pricing estimations through calculators, suitable for products where the pricing logic can be clearly defined and automated. Quick Quote offers a more hands-on approach, enabling direct communication and negotiation on pricing. It is ideal for merchants who deal with high-value items, custom projects, or services where a standard pricing structure may not be applicable. Both apps provide value in their respective niches of Shopify pricing but offer very different user experiences and features.

For businesses seeking to offer immediate, transparent pricing based on customer-defined parameters, Calconic ‑ Calculator Builder, if it provides the necessary calculation capabilities, would be the preferred choice. These businesses likely sell configurable products or services where the cost can be easily computed using specific variables.
However, for merchants who require more control over pricing, offer highly customized solutions, or value direct negotiation with customers, Quick Quote presents a more suitable option. Its quote request system allows for personalized communication and tailored pricing, which is particularly valuable for high-value or project-based sales. While Calconic may be suitable for simpler product pricing, Quick Quote is ideal for complex, bespoke sales processes.
Based on the feature set, Quick Quote likely offers a simpler setup due to its focus on a streamlined quote request process. Calconic might require more configuration to build complex calculators.
Quick Quote is better suited for products with highly variable pricing because it allows for direct negotiation and customized quotes. Calconic relies on predefined formulas, which might not be suitable for all complex pricing scenarios.
The provided description of Calconic does not explicitly mention customer communication features. It primarily focuses on the calculator functionality.
Quick Quote creates an editable quote in the app admin, allowing merchants to send back pricing discounts. Customers can accept & checkout, or comment on the quote.
Quick Quote has significantly stronger social proof based on the higher rating (5/5) and a substantially larger number of reviews (56) compared to Calconic's 4.1/5 rating and 19 reviews.
